示例#1
0
        public void Cant_GetPassword_If_QuestionAndAnswer_Arent_Defined()
        {
            // Arrange
            User user = new User("username", password, passwordCoder);

            // Act
            var newPassword = user.GetPassword("otherPasswordAnswer", passwordCoder);

            // Assert
        }
示例#2
0
        public void Can_Get_Password_If_PasswordCoder_Supports_It()
        {
            // Arrange
            User user = new User("username", password, passwordCoder);

            // Act
            var retrievedPassword = user.GetPassword(passwordCoder);

            // Assert
            Assert.AreEqual(password, retrievedPassword, "Passwords aren't equal.");
        }